91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

PostgreSQL中rollup如何使用

小樊
101
2024-09-06 03:56:50
欄目: 云計算

在 PostgreSQL 中,ROLLUP 是一種分組集合的方式,它可以讓你在一個查詢中同時得到多個分組的結果

下面是一個使用 ROLLUP 的示例:

SELECT category, sub_category, COUNT(*) as total_sales
FROM sales_data
GROUP BY ROLLUP (category, sub_category);

這個查詢會返回以下結果:

  • 按照 categorysub_category 分組的銷售數據匯總。
  • 按照 category 分組的銷售數據匯總。
  • 所有銷售數據的總匯總。

在這個例子中,ROLLUP 首先按照 categorysub_category 對數據進行分組,然后按照 category 進行分組,最后得到所有數據的總匯總。這樣,你可以在一個查詢中得到多個層次的匯總信息。

需要注意的是,ROLLUP 只能在 GROUP BY 子句中使用,并且必須位于括號內。此外,ROLLUP 還可以與其他分組函數(如 CUBEGROUPING SETS)一起使用,以獲取更復雜的分組匯總。

0
东乌珠穆沁旗| 彩票| 游戏| 团风县| 离岛区| 盐源县| 兰州市| 搜索| 德庆县| 普宁市| 永修县| 方正县| 日土县| 汾阳市| 奎屯市| 灵川县| 台东县| 阳新县| 南充市| 永宁县| 酉阳| 临漳县| 崇明县| 黄梅县| 梁河县| 普兰县| 白朗县| 昭苏县| 长阳| 成安县| 沙雅县| 龙陵县| 黄龙县| 大方县| 水富县| 沁阳市| 松溪县| 山东| 墨玉县| 新宁县| 襄垣县|